TTFB (time to first byte) is the number of milliseconds it takes for a client’s browser to receive the first byte of the response from the web server. Usually, TTFB can be improved with faster hosting and server optimizations. TTFB

First Input Delay (FID) measures the time from when the user interacts with your site for the first time (click a link, tap on a button, etc.) to the time when the browser is able to respond to that interaction. Google recommends keeping FID below 100ms for a good user experience. FID

FCP (First Contentful Paint) measures the time from a user’s navigation to when the browser renders the first bit of content from the DOM. In other words, FCP marks the time at which the first text or image is painted for the user. According to PageSpeed Insights, FCP should occur in under 2 seconds. FCP

Interaction to Next Paint (INP) is a web performance metric that measures user interface responsiveness – how quickly a website responds to user interactions like clicks or key presses. Specifically, it measures how much time elapses between a user interaction like a click or key press and the next time the user sees a visual update on the page. INP

Largest Contentful Paint (LCP) is a metric that measures when the largest content in the viewport is rendered. It is used to measure how long it takes for the main content of your webpage to appear on the screen. Everything below 2.5s is considered good LCP time by PageSpeed Insights. LCP
